Work out the value of 3x + 2y when x=4 and y=-5

3x + 2y =

3*4 + 2*-5=

12 + -10 = 2

Just substitute the equation with the given

The given are 
x = 4 and y = -5
the equation is
3x + 2y
3 (4) + 2 (-5) = 12 - 10 = 2
